In several large computing clusters which are in the supercomputer centers United Kingdom, Germany, Switzerland, Poland and Spain, are revealed traces of breakings of infrastructure and installation of malicious software for the hidden Mining Cryptocurrency Monero (XMR). Detailed analysis of incidents is not available yet, but according to preliminary data systems were compromised as a result of theft of registration data from systems of the researchers having access on start of tasks in a cluster.
